Bright Memorial Arboretum
Arboretum Mountbatten Ave, Bright, Victoria, AustraliaA wide variety of trees planted in a large park in memorial to two firefighters killed in a helicopter accident in 1978. This park is completely fenced, making it a perfect place to letthe dog run free. New park benches have also been installed for those morecontemplative.

Shady Brook Cottages
Shady Brook 20 Mountain View Walk,, Harrietville, Victoria, AustraliaA spectacular 14-acre garden of which over 5 acres are landscaped, bounded by OvensRiver and a mountain backdrop of natural forest. The Garden is only 20 years old but itsmicro environment has accelerated maturity. Exotic trees include Maples, Oaks,Magnolias, Dogwoods, Birches and Conifers, many of which are rare. The Golden Assayer’s Garden
Golden Assayer's Garden 49 Robertson St, Myrtleford, Victoria, AustraliaThis historic property and land previously featured an entrance to Reform gold mine in the 1800's. Thoughtfully landscaped to balance old world charm with naturalistic planting - designed to attract birds, bees and insects.
